Santon Musk—historically sourced from rare musk deer or synthetic alternatives with similar depth—has long intrigued perfumers for its warm, earthy core with subtle vanilla and amber undertones. In recent years, it’s re-emerged amid a broader cultural shift toward vintage and artisanal ingredients. Consumers describe it as a “mysterious whisper” on the skin—familiar yet elusive—perfect for those drawn to evocative, layered scents. This resurgence reflects a growing appreciation for scent as storytelling, not just fragrance.

Many modern alternatives aim for smoother, sweeter profiles. Saxon Musk stands apart with its raw, slightly ambery heart—a dry, woody depth less common in today’s dominant oakmilk or amber-based notes.
